It looks much better. However, I don't know if the damage can be undone to the public perception. It's too bad it took Acura this long to realize. Who ever green lighted the grille should be fired. The 3G was a monster when it came to sales. Only the 3-series would beat it in sales. This was despite the fact that it was a FWD and didn't have as much power as some of its rivals. The 4G addressed all that and is a better car than the 3G in every way except the polarizing style.
